Transaction 493553063af2830521fd881432eed5856cfe5f61830775ebc3c89ba4b7a56cae
1 Input
1 Output
-
493553063af2830521fd881432eed5856cfe5f61830775ebc3c89ba4b7a56cae:0
- value
- 57753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edfed247bb37d21f22ed6b9b2240f089a78ff820 OP_EQUAL
- address
- 3PPRLJtoT4er6bKCXdZf7YZpHNr9i7d8B2